Unfortunately, there are no direct flights from Makassar (UPG) to Lusaka (LUN). All routes involve connecting flights.
Connecting flights typically involve a layover in major hubs like Dubai, Addis Ababa, or Johannesburg. The total travel time can range from 15 to 25 hours or more, depending on the layover duration and chosen airlines. Check Traveloka for the most up-to-date flight options and schedules.

Lusaka is primarily served by Kenneth Kaunda International Airport (LUN). The airport offers standard amenities including restaurants, shops, and currency exchange services. It's advisable to check the airport's official website for the most up-to-date information on facilities and services.
Taxis and ride-hailing services are readily available outside the airport. Negotiate fares beforehand with taxi drivers. Pre-booked airport transfers are also a convenient option for a hassle-free arrival.
